RMIT is a world-renowned institution of higher learning in Australia with a strong focus on applied and professional education.

The university has its roots in the working class of Melbourne and was established in 1887 as a night school for working men. RMIT quickly grew, becoming a technical college in 1900 and a full-fledged university in 1992.

Today, RMIT is a leading provider of vocational and professional education, with over 80,000 students enrolled across more than 500 programs. The university has campuses in Melbourne's CBD, inner city suburbs, and regional Victoria.

RMIT is renowned for its hands-on, practical approach to education, which prepares students for success in their chosen careers. The university offers undergraduate and postgraduate programs across various disciplines, including business, design, engineering, health sciences, information technology, communication, and media studies.

RMIT's History and Evolution: A Brief Overview

RMIT University was founded in 1887 as a workingmen’s college. It was established to provide technical and further education for the ‘working classes’ and to 'open up' education opportunities that had been previously unavailable.

The college initially only offered evening classes in subjects such as science, mathematics, English, and literature but soon expanded to include daytime classes and full-time courses. In 1900, it began offering associate degrees and, in 1911, became a full-fledged university.

Over the next few decades, RMIT experienced rapid growth, expanding its city campus and opening new campuses in Bundoora (north of Melbourne) and Brunswick (west of Melbourne). By the mid-1970s, RMIT had become one of Australia’s largest universities, with over 20,000 students enrolled.

In the 1980s and 1990s, RMIT underwent a significant change as it responded to changes in government policy and industry needs. The university introduced new courses and restructured existing ones, resulting in a more flexible approach to learning that better met the needs of students and employers.

Today, RMIT is a globally connected university with campuses in Vietnam and Spain and strong partnerships with leading institutions worldwide. It offers over 300 programs at all levels of study, catering to students from all backgrounds. With over 84,000 students enrolled across its campuses, RMIT is one of Australia’s largest universities.
